WitrynaCollegedunia Team. Newton's first law of motion is also known as the law of inertia. It states that a body continues to remain in the state of rest or motion until an external force is applied. If no external force is applied to the object, it continues to move at a uniform speed. The square of the orbital period of a planet is directly proportional to the cube of the semi-major axis of its orbit. The third law, published by Kepler in 1619, captures the relationship between the distance of planets from the Sun, and their orbital periods. Symbolically, the law can be expressed as.

Newton’s First Law of Motion Example in Daily Life. … dyeing chargeWitrynaNewton's first law says that if the net force on an object is zero ( \Sigma F=0 ΣF = 0 ), then that object will have zero acceleration. That doesn't necessarily mean the object is at rest, but it means that the velocity is constant. The first law asserts that if heat is recognized as a form of energy, then the total energy of a system plus its surroundings is conserved; in other words, the total energy of the universe remains constant.
